Police ask for help to identify men after robbery

By Neil Speight

2nd May 2022 | Local News

ESSEX Police has asked residents if they recognise two people as they appeal for witnesses and information following reports of a robbery in Pitsea on Sunday, 5 March.

It was reported that the victim was forced to hand over his phone, coat and money by two men at around 4.30pm as he walked along Moretons.

The victim, 20s, was unhurt.

A police statement says: "We'd like to speak to anyone who was in the area at the time or who may have CCTV, dash cam or doorbell footage to contact us.
